43 /*
44  * Kernel per-process accounting / statistics
45  * (not necessarily resident except when running).
46  *
47  * Locking key:
48  *      b - created at fork, never changes
49  *      c - locked by proc mtx
50  *      j - locked by proc slock
51  *      k - only accessed by curthread
52  */
53 struct pstats {
54 #define	pstat_startzero	p_cru
55 	struct	rusage p_cru;		/* Stats for reaped children. */
56 	struct	itimerval p_timer[3];	/* (j) Virtual-time timers. */
57 #define	pstat_endzero	pstat_startcopy
58 
59 #define	pstat_startcopy	p_prof
60 	struct uprof {			/* Profile arguments. */
61 		caddr_t	pr_base;	/* (c + j) Buffer base. */
62 		u_long	pr_size;	/* (c + j) Buffer size. */
63 		u_long	pr_off;		/* (c + j) PC offset. */
64 		u_long	pr_scale;	/* (c + j) PC scaling. */
65 	} p_prof;
66 #define	pstat_endcopy	p_start
67 	struct	timeval p_start;	/* (b) Starting time. */
68 };
69 
70 #ifdef _KERNEL
71 
72 /*
73  * Kernel shareable process resource limits.  Because this structure
74  * is moderately large but changes infrequently, it is normally
75  * shared copy-on-write after forks.
76  */
77 struct plimit {
78 	struct	rlimit pl_rlimit[RLIM_NLIMITS];
79 	int	pl_refcnt;		/* number of references */
80 };
81 
82 /*-
83  * Per uid resource consumption
84  *
85  * Locking guide:
86  * (a) Constant from inception
87  * (b) Lockless, updated using atomics
88  * (c) Locked by global uihashtbl_mtx
89  * (d) Locked by the ui_vmsize_mtx
90  */
91 struct uidinfo {
92 	LIST_ENTRY(uidinfo) ui_hash;	/* (c) hash chain of uidinfos */
93 	struct mtx ui_vmsize_mtx;
94 	vm_ooffset_t ui_vmsize;		/* (d) swap reservation by uid */
95 	long	ui_sbsize;		/* (b) socket buffer space consumed */
96 	long	ui_proccnt;		/* (b) number of processes */
97 	long	ui_ptscnt;		/* (b) number of pseudo-terminals */
98 	uid_t	ui_uid;			/* (a) uid */
99 	u_int	ui_ref;			/* (b) reference count */
100 };
